DELHI, NY – The Hartwick Hawks (0-4, 0-3) dropped another conference match to Nazareth College (2-7, 2-0) today by the score of 9-0. The match was played both outside and inside at SUNY Delhi. The loss marks the second
in two days for the Hawks.
Freshman
Krishna Patel (Brunswick, ME/Pine Tree Academy), at first singles, played his best tennis of the young season but fell short losing to Tyler Williams of Nazareth by a score of 6-2, 6-4. Junior
Ross Braue (Canastota, NY/Canastota) turned in another good performance at fifth singles but was bested by Lamar Hurt 6-3, 6-3.
The Hawks are scheduled to play at Utica College on Saturday, April 16 at 1 p.m.
